Art Models 4 Overview"Art Models 4" by Maureen and Douglas Johnson is a photographic guide that presents a diverse selection of figures for artists without access to live models. The book features high-resolution images of models posed in classical and modern styles, set against a clean background that enhances the figures.
The publication includes 64 highly requested pose sets, showcasing a variety of interests and features, with each pose presented from four angles: front, back, and both sides. The layout allows for large views, facilitating direct use for artistic practice. Additionally, it includes two bonus 360-degree poses, offering sequences of images from different angles.
